IPDN's 18.87% Surge: What's Fueling the Volatility?
Summary
• Professional (IPDN) trades at $3.1262, up 18.87% intraday
• Intraday high of $3.21 and low of $2.71 mark a volatile session
• Turnover rate hits 76.14%, signaling intense short-term interest
• Dynamic PE of -3.26 highlights valuation divergence
Professional’s explosive move has ignited market speculation, with the stock surging from its 100D average of $2.23 to near its 30D average of $3.11. The sharp reversal from a short-term bearish trend to a breakout above key technical levels has traders scrambling to decipher catalysts. With no official news and a lack of sector alignment, the focus shifts to technical triggers and speculative momentum.
Technical Reversal and Short-Term Momentum Shift
The 18.87% intraday surge in IPDNIPDN-- reflects a sharp reversal from a short-term bearish trend, as indicated by the Kline pattern summary. The stock opened at $2.71 and immediately tested its 100D average of $2.23 before rallying to a session high of $3.21. This move coincided with a MACD crossover where the histogram turned negative (-0.09), signaling bearish momentum, yet the price defied the indicator by surging past the 30D MA of $3.11. The RSI at 51.74 suggests neutral momentum, but the sharp intraday move suggests aggressive short-term buying pressure, likely driven by algorithmic trading or speculative positioning ahead of an unannounced catalyst.

Backtest Professional Stock Performance
Below is the event-study back-test you requested. Key assumptions we made (so you know exactly what was tested): • “Intraday surge” was defined as a single-day close-to-previous-close gain ≥ 19 %. • Historical window: 1 Jan 2022 – 11 Sep 2025 (latest available close). • Price series used: daily close. • All 19 occurrences during the period were included; no additional filters applied. Findings at a glance • 1- to 10-day horizons showed no statistically significant drift after a ≥19 % day. • Around day 18–19 the average cumulative excess return turned positive and reached ~26 % versus ~3 % for the benchmark, but significance was only detected on day 18–19. • Win-rate (proportion of positive post-event returns) never exceeded ~56 % on any horizon, indicating high dispersion across events.
